Taman Meru Permai (P/L 1976) in Klang, Selangor recorded 3 subsale transactions between 2021 and 2026, with a median price of RM405K and a median price per square foot (PSF) of RM214.

This area consists exclusively of residential properties, with no commercial listings recorded.

Price remained flat, and PSF growth was PSF remained flat. The median price is RM405K, with most transactions falling within a stable range of RM400K to RM410K, and a typical market range of RM400K to RM414K.

Most transactions involved 1 - 1 1/2 storey terraced, though some variety exists in the market.

For price per square foot, the median is RM214, with most transactions between RM211 and RM217. The usual range is RM196.32 to RM231.32, showing that most units are priced quite close to each other. A typical spread (IQR) of RM35.00 and an average deviation (MAD) of RM3 indicate a highly stable PSF trend across properties.
